Xerox Theory and You
Manage episode 364649513 series 2778740
Andy and Anthony talk about “Xerox Theory” a strategic Magic concept involving cantrips, land count, a balance of resources. Andy explains the history and origins of the idea, as documented by Mike Flores’s 2005 article. They talk about how the concept applies differently in early and contemporary Magic and how it’s relevant, or not, to different types of decks. They also talk about Gunk Slug for some reason.
